HUAWAI IDU Optix RTN 620 Installation and commissioning
RTN 620 Features
The air interface of the OptiX RTN 620 supports 7MHz to 56MHz channel bandwidth and QPSK to 256 QAM modulation mode. The TDM air interface is flexibly configurable from 4E1 to 75E1; while the throughput of native Ethernet service is flexibly configurable from 10 Mbit/s to 400 Mbit/s. ON ON ON Installation Horizontally Polarized Antenna Vertically Polarized Antenna Polarization Marking Installation Login WebLCT The IP address of your laptop must be of the range 129.9.x.x, & the subnet mask must be 255.255.0.0 WebLCT: User name is admin and password is admin.
